WebFeb 4, 2024 · How to prepare recycled yarn for knitting. Once the yarn is unraveled, wind it around something to form it into skeins. Tie it in a few places, so it doesn’t get tangled when you wash or dye it. If you plan to over-dye your recycled yarn, soak and rinse it first, and then pop it into the dye pot to give it a new life!
WebStep 2: Blocking. A. Lay your damp knitting right-side up on the your blocking surface and gently nudge the piece to your finished measurements. If you’re using the Knitter’s Block, place the Check Your Gauge Cloth onto the assembled tiles so it will be under your knitting. Each check measures approximately 1" square. WebApr 9, 2024 · Weave in the ends. Use a yarn needle to sew the ends into the edges of the hood. Sew in and out of the edges of the hood to secure and hide any excess threads. When you have sewn in most of the yarn, tie the end through a stitch. Then, cut the excess yarn 0.25 in (0.64 cm) from the stitch. Your hood is finished!
WebMar 17, 2015 · Step 2: Knit between 1 and 3 rounds. This will depend on the sweater. For James which has a gauge of 25 stitches then the neckline requires 3 rounds of knitting. For the neckline of Lila above, which has a gauge of 16 stitches I only did a single round of knitting. You should decide based on how it looks.
